.ks-tenant-switcher{padding:var(--ks-space-3) var(--ks-space-4) var(--ks-space-2);display:flex;flex-direction:column;gap:var(--ks-space-1)}.ks-tenant-switcher-label{font-size:var(--ks-fs-xs);text-transform:uppercase;letter-spacing:.04em;color:var(--ks-color-text-sidebar);opacity:.7}.ks-tenant-switcher-card{display:flex;align-items:center;gap:var(--ks-space-2);padding:var(--ks-space-2);background:var(--ks-color-sidebar-tenant-card-bg);border:1px solid var(--ks-color-sidebar-tenant-card-border);border-radius:var(--ks-radius-lg);transition:background .12s,border-color .12s}.ks-tenant-switcher-card:hover{background:var(--ks-color-sidebar-tenant-card-hover)}.ks-tenant-switcher-card:focus-within{border-color:var(--ks-color-accent);box-shadow:var(--ks-shadow-focus)}.ks-tenant-switcher-card-pending{opacity:.6}.ks-tenant-switcher-fav{width:22px;height:22px;border-radius:var(--ks-radius-sm);background:var(--ks-color-sidebar-fav-bg);color:var(--ks-color-sidebar-fav-text);display:inline-flex;align-items:center;justify-content:center;font-size:var(--ks-fs-xs);font-weight:var(--ks-fw-bold);flex-shrink:0}.ks-tenant-switcher-select{flex:1 1;min-width:0;appearance:none;-webkit-appearance:none;background:transparent;border:none;outline:none;color:var(--ks-color-text-on-sidebar);font-size:var(--ks-fs-md);font-weight:var(--ks-fw-semibold);font-family:inherit;cursor:pointer;padding:2px 0;text-overflow:ellipsis}.ks-tenant-switcher-select:disabled{cursor:default;opacity:.8}.ks-tenant-switcher-select option{background:var(--ks-color-sidebar-tenant-card-bg);color:var(--ks-color-text-on-sidebar)}.ks-tenant-switcher-chev{width:16px;height:16px;color:var(--ks-color-text-sidebar);flex-shrink:0;pointer-events:none}.ks-tenant-switcher-error{font-size:var(--ks-fs-xs);color:var(--ks-color-error)}